Making a debut with much talked about 'Lust Stories' on Netflix in 2018, actor Ridhi Khakhar who is now being seen in 'The Whistleblower', streaming on Sony Liv feels that the former got her immense recognition and therefore multiple audition calls and acting tests."I didn't get many before, but people started reaching out after 'Lust Stories'. In the end, it is all about preparing yourself, waiting for that moment of recognition and making good use of it," she tells IANS.Originally from Canada, she started her career in 2016 and continues to model for major fashion designers.

Khakhar says that the crucial reason for signing up for 'The Whistleblower' was the fact that the character was not just another pretty face."Her character made me delve deep into sibling dynamics, there was so much new to discover. How does each sibling get treated in a family and what kind of a person does that make them for the real world? It is all about getting a character that helps you see the world from a different perspective, which can be very interesting," she says.
